◆ flux()

template<class ScalarType, class GridGeometry>
template<class Problem, class ElementVolumeVariables, class ElementFluxVarsCache>
Scalar Dumux::CCTpfaDarcysLaw< ScalarType, GridGeometry, false >::flux ( const Problem & problem,
const Element & element,
const FVElementGeometry & fvGeometry,
const ElementVolumeVariables & elemVolVars,
const SubControlVolumeFace & scvf,
int phaseIdx,
const ElementFluxVarsCache & elemFluxVarsCache )
inlinestatic
Note
This assembles the term \(-|\sigma| \mathbf{n}^T \mathbf{K} \left( \nabla p - \rho \mathbf{g} \right)\), where \(|\sigma|\) is the area of the face and \(\mathbf{n}\) is the outer normal vector. Thus, the flux is given in N*m, and can be converted into a volume flux (m^3/s) or mass flux (kg/s) by applying an upwind scheme for the mobility or the product of density and mobility, respectively.
